原文:linux:C++的socket編程

基本的局域網聊天 局域網聊天TCP服務端: 局域網聊天TCP客戶端: 客戶端服務端雙向異步聊天源碼 以上的局域網聊天應用有一個很重要的缺點, 服務器只能顯示客戶端發送的消息, 卻無法給客戶端發送消息, 這個很尷尬 通過使用C中的select 函數, 實現一個異步聊天工具: 異步聊天服務端代碼: 異步聊天客戶端代碼: 局域網內服務端和有限個客戶端聊天源碼 以上的局域網聊天只能支持一個用戶, 我們還 ...

2017-01-03 03:22 1 23617 推薦指數:

查看詳情

linuxC++socket編程

閱讀目錄   基本的局域網聊天   客戶端服務端雙向異步聊天源碼   局域網內服務端和有限個客戶端聊天源碼   完美異步聊天服務端和客戶端源碼   C++定時器   select異步代碼   pthead多線程   參考 ...

Thu Mar 08 00:29:00 CST 2018 1 1138
c++ linux socket編程 c++網絡編程

聲明:大部分代碼來自這篇博客http://www.cnblogs.com/diligenceday/p/6241021.html, 感謝博主 思路: 思路很重要呦~~~ socket詳細信息,思路:http://www.cnblogs.com/renfanzi/p/5713054.html ...

Thu Jan 10 19:22:00 CST 2019 0 848
Linux下的C++ socket編程實例

閱讀目錄   基本的局域網聊天   客戶端服務端雙向異步聊天源碼   局域網內服務端和有限個客戶端聊天源碼   完美異步聊天服務端和客戶端源碼   C++定時器   select異步代碼   pthead多線程 服務端:  服務器端先初始化socket ...

Wed Oct 03 01:38:00 CST 2018 0 12864
C++ Socket 編程

介紹 Socket編程讓你沮喪嗎?從man pages中很難得到有用的信息嗎?你想跟上時代去編Internet相關的程序,但是為你在調用 connect() 前的bind() 的結構而不知所措?等等… 好在我已經將這些事完成了,我將和所有人共享我的知識了。如果你了解 C 語言並想穿過網絡編程 ...

Tue Jul 10 01:17:00 CST 2012 5 30539
socket編程(C++)

介紹 ​ 網絡上的兩個程序通過一個雙向的通信連接實現數據的交換,這個連接的一端稱為一個socket。 過程介紹 ​ 服務器端和客戶端通信過程如下所示: ![socket通信過程](http://images.cnblogs.com/cnblogs_com/helloworldcode ...

Thu Mar 28 06:14:00 CST 2019 0 8296
C++socket編程

環境搭建 開發環境- Clion 本地安裝了vs2017,可以選擇使用vs自帶的C++編譯器,如下圖: 對於vc++ 引入庫文件 socket依賴winsocket.h、winsocket.lib和winsocket.dll 在CMakeLists中: 全部 ...

Mon Jul 20 06:23:00 CST 2020 0 755
C++socket編程學習

前言   不得不承認作為一個前端開發,仍有一個后台開發的夢。從socket通信開始學習,在工作之余補充學習點相關知識,記錄下學習的過程。 服務端   服務器代碼如下,在設置listen之后,通過accept獲取對應的socket連接並創建線程進行通信,通信完成后關閉對應線程 ...

Mon Feb 29 19:01:00 CST 2016 0 2946
C++ Socket編程步驟

sockets(套接字)編程有三種,流式套接字(SOCK_STREAM),數據報套接字(SOCK_DGRAM),原始套接字(SOCK_RAW);基於TCP的socket編程是采用的流式套接字。 服務器端編程的步驟:1:加載套接字庫,創建套接字(WSAStartup()/socket ...

Fri Jul 28 22:07:00 CST 2017 0 18498
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M